Subject: Re: [PATCH] Input: elan_i2c - add ELAN060C to the ACPI table

On Tue, Nov 07, 2017 at 04:12:54AM -0500, Kai-Heng Feng wrote:
> ELAN060C touchpad uses elan_i2c as its driver. It can be
> found on Lenovo ideapad 320-14AST.
> 
> BugLink: https://bugs.launchpad.net/bugs/1727544
> Signed-off-by: Kai-Heng Feng <kai.heng.feng@...onical.com>

Applied, thank you.

> ---
>  drivers/input/mouse/elan_i2c_core.c | 1 +
>  1 file changed, 1 insertion(+)
> 
> diff --git a/drivers/input/mouse/elan_i2c_core.c b/drivers/input/mouse/elan_i2c_core.c
> index 6d6b092e2da9..d6135900da64 100644
> --- a/drivers/input/mouse/elan_i2c_core.c
> +++ b/drivers/input/mouse/elan_i2c_core.c
> @@ -1258,6 +1258,7 @@ static const struct acpi_device_id elan_acpi_id[] = {
>  	{ "ELAN0605", 0 },
>  	{ "ELAN0609", 0 },
>  	{ "ELAN060B", 0 },
> +	{ "ELAN060C", 0 },
>  	{ "ELAN0611", 0 },
>  	{ "ELAN1000", 0 },
>  	{ }
